We didn't have enough snow for XC skiing, but the ice is thick enough for skating. So, the crew of http://OutYourBackdoor.com outdoor action got into gear! My brother and I did a little speed skating on the Red Cedar River that flows through the MSU Campus in East Lansing, Michigan. We also broke out the ski poles and did some ski-skating moves. Lots of students watched and cheered us from the sidewalks and bridges. (Local lakes have thick, safe ice -- the river was just barely OK.) (Video shot by Tim Potter.
